ForgeCAD Software License

Copyright (c) 2026 Ruben Kostandyan

This license applies to the ForgeCAD npm package, command-line interface,
browser application code, bundled runtime, and packaged assets distributed with
ForgeCAD (the "Software"). Public example files and public agent skills may be
distributed under a separate license when a repository or file says so.

1. Free Personal Non-Commercial Use

You may install and use the Software for free for personal non-commercial use,
learning, experimentation, evaluation, and other non-commercial work.

2. Pro Commercial Use

If you use the Software as a human-operated CAD tool for commercial work, you
need an active ForgeCAD Pro subscription unless ForgeCAD has separately agreed
to different terms in writing. This includes designing models for customers,
client work, paid freelance work, employer work, products for sale, or funded
commercial projects.

3. Enterprise Backend And Embedded Use

You need a ForgeCAD Enterprise agreement before using the Software in an
automated backend, hosted service, embedded application, product integration,
or other application workflow that calls ForgeCAD on behalf of users, customers,
jobs, scripts, agents, or external systems.

4. Current Pricing And Plan Details

Plan names, current pricing, and checkout paths are available at:

https://forgecad.io/pricing

If you have a written agreement with ForgeCAD, that agreement controls where it
conflicts with this license.

5. Your Models And Outputs

You own the models, scripts, exports, images, reports, and other outputs you
create with ForgeCAD, subject to your rights in any input material and subject
to using ForgeCAD under the required plan for your use case.

6. Restrictions

Except as allowed by this license or by a separate written agreement, you may
not:

- sell, sublicense, rent, lease, or redistribute the Software;
- remove copyright, license, pricing, telemetry, or subscription notices;
- offer the Software itself as a hosted, embedded, white-label, or API service;
- bypass license checks, subscription checks, usage limits, or technical
  protection measures;
- use ForgeCAD trademarks, logos, or branding in a way that implies endorsement
  or affiliation without written permission.

7. No Warranty

The Software is provided "as is", without warranty of any kind, express or
implied, including warranties of merchantability, fitness for a particular
purpose, non-infringement, availability, or accuracy.

8. Limitation Of Liability

To the maximum extent permitted by law, ForgeCAD and Ruben Kostandyan will not
be liable for any indirect, incidental, special, consequential, exemplary, or
punitive damages, or for lost profits, lost revenue, lost data, business
interruption, manufacturing losses, or procurement losses arising from use of
the Software.

9. Termination

Your rights under this license terminate automatically if you violate these
terms. After termination, you must stop using the Software unless ForgeCAD
reinstates your rights in writing.

10. Contact

For Enterprise licensing, commercial questions, or alternative licensing terms,
contact:

contact@forgecad.io
